Feger scores runner-up finish with World of Outlaws at Spoon River
A swing with the World of Outlaws Real American Beer Late Model Series brought Bloomington, Illinois’ Jason Feger to Highland Speedway on Wednesday for the Beat the Heat 40.
With 31 entries taking on the quarter-mile oval, Feger followed up a runner-up showing in his heat with a consistent fifth-place finish in the 40-lap opener.
On Thursday at Spoon River Speedway, he again finished second in his heat before turning in his best run of the week in the feature. Charging forward three positions, Feger crossed the line in second, joining winner Bobby Pierce and third-place finisher Brian Shirley on the podium.
After Friday’s first leg of the doubleheader at Maquoketa Speedway was rained out, Feger returned to the Iowa oval on Saturday for the Hawkeye 100 finale. Rolling off from the fifth row in the $20,000-to-win main event, he came away with an 11th-place finish.
